Frank Reys

Frank Reys (c.1931–1984) was the first, and to date, only Australian Aboriginal jockey to win the prestigious Melbourne Cup when, in 1973, he rode to victory on Gala Supreme.

Reys' career began in Northern Queensland. He raced in North Queensland, Brisbane, Sydney, and Melbourne and Victoria and rode his first winner in 1948 as a 16 year old. In his career as a jockey he had 1,329 winning rides, his 1973 Melbourne Cup win being one of his last. His last ride, also a win, was as a 45 year old in 1976.
